Each year, in North Carolina, an average of 289 students graduate with credentials in biomedical engineering. If you too are interested in a career in biomedical engineering, North Carolina has 10 biomedical engineering schools for you to choose from. Tuition at North Carolina's biomedical engineering schools is approximately $10,571 per year for a degree in biomedical engineering.
The largest biomedical engineering school in North Carolina, by student population is Duke University. It is located in Durham. Approximately 175 students graduated with a biomedical engineering degree from Duke University in 2009, which is 61% of the total state biomedical engineering graduates for that year. If you decide to attend Duke University, you can expect to pay approximately $38,741 per year to earn your degree in biomedical engineering.
A majority of those with a degree in biomedical engineering choose to become biomedical engineers. If you are planning on working in the state after graduation, you should know that the job outlook for biomedical engineers in North Carolina is good. Approximately 450 biomedical engineers are currently working in North Carolina. This number is projected to increase to 800 by the year 2018. This indicates a 79% change in the number of biomedical engineers in North Carolina.
In North Carolina, as a biomedical engineer, you can expect to earn a salary of anywhere from less than $48,165 per year to more than $109,780 per year. The median salary for biomedical engineers in North Carolina is $76,925 per year.
